What Documents do you need to Refinance My Vehicle Loan?

Proof of income: The most important document needed to refinance your vehicle loan is proof that you have an income. This includes your most recent pay statements, tax returns, and bank statements. Lenders must see evidence that your income is steady and that you can afford to repay the loans. Your income will impact how much you are able to borrow and what rate of interest you get.

Credit Report: Another important factor that lenders will consider is your credit score, which can be used to decide whether you should refinance your auto loan. Equifax and TransUnion offer free credit reports. Check your credit report carefully before applying for refinancing. Although you might be able to refinance if you have low credit scores, your interest rate will likely be higher if you do not.

Current Auto Loan Documents: This includes the loan agreement as well as the title and registration. This information is used by the lender to determine the exact value of your car as well as the amount you owe.

Photo ID of Insurance: If you want to refinance your vehicle financing loan, you'll also have to provide proof that you are insured. For the duration of the loan, the lender will require that you maintain full coverage insurance. The lender should be named as the lien holder on your vehicle in the insurance policy.

Documentation proving identity: When you refinance an auto loan, it is necessary to prove your identity. This could include a driver's license, passport, or any other government-issued identification. The lender must verify that you are real and legally authorized to sign a loan agreement.

Also, the lender will require proof of residency. This can happen by providing a utility invoice, lease agreement, or any other documents that prove your name as well as address. To send you important documents regarding your loan, like statements or notices, the lender needs to be able to locate you.

Vehicle Information: You must provide the necessary details: Make, model, year, mileage, and more. This information will help the lender determine the car's actual value and to estimate the loan amount. You might also need to inform the lender about any modifications or damages to your vehicle.
